Transponder keys
Transponder keys are common in newer cars. This type of key does not require batteries and relies on radio waves to activate a microchip on the immobilizer. The immobilizer then checks the digital fingerprint of the key, and then disconnects it when it matches. This stops the car from being started by anyone else with access to the keys. The RR021 device manufactured by Abrites Diagnostics for Renault/ Dacia allows key programming in all key addition and ALL KEYS LOOSE conditions for the Master III & Kangoo II models. This device is compatible both with the AVDI interface and active AMS.

Renault created the hands-free cards 20 years ago. They have become a worldwide hit. The small device is bigger than a credit card and has transformed the ways we use our cars. Pascaline Head of the division for cross-cutting products at Renault discusses how this revolutionary invention came about.
The first version was a small, circular device that could either be placed in the pockets of the driver or under the door handle. It was connected to the immobilizer and used to unlock doors and to start the car. It also kept information about the car, such as the serial number, registration details, equipment and mileage.
Over the years the hands-free cards have been refined and improved with new features added to their arsenal. For example, the latest version has a brand new welcome sequence that lights up and sounds when you approach the vehicle. It can also detect the owner and adjust the settings accordingly.
